Akpabio: DSS Enforces Security at National Assembly Amid Impeachment Rumors

This morning, the National Assembly resembles a fortified area as personnel from the Department of State Security (DSS) have taken control in response to rumors of an impending impeachment against Senate President Goodswill Akpabio.
DSS operatives have been deployed following reports of a potential move by some discontented Northern Senators who are allegedly dissatisfied with President Bola Tinubu, and are said to be reigniting previous efforts to remove Akpabio from his position.
Globally, legislative bodies typically maintain dedicated security teams to ensure order and safety within their premises. Additional security agencies are often present to safeguard lives and property, particularly when internal security is insufficient to handle potential disruptions.
This morning, OrderPaper noted that DSS personnel, dressed in dark suits and wearing sunglasses, have been stationed at various entry points from the main entrance to the secondary gate, securing all access points within the National Assembly grounds.
